然而,在使用VMware进行虚拟机管理时,一个常见且令人头疼的问题便是VMware Tools的安装出错
这不仅会影响虚拟机的性能优化,还可能导致一系列兼容性、共享文件夹访问、图形界面显示等问题
本文将深入探讨VMware Tools安装出错的原因,并提供一系列切实可行的解决方案,帮助用户顺利安装VMware Tools,确保虚拟机的稳定运行
一、VMware Tools的重要性 VMware Tools是VMware提供的一套实用程序,用于增强虚拟机的性能和功能
它包括但不限于以下功能: 时间同步:确保虚拟机与主机之间的时间保持一致
- 图形性能优化:提升虚拟机中的图形显示性能,尤其是在全屏或窗口模式下
- 共享文件夹:在主机和虚拟机之间轻松共享文件和文件夹
- 鼠标指针优化:改善鼠标在虚拟机与主机之间的切换体验
- 自动调整屏幕分辨率:根据虚拟机窗口大小自动调整屏幕分辨率
- 备份与恢复:提供额外的备份和恢复选项,增强数据安全
二、VMware Tools安装出错的原因分析 VMware Tools安装出错的原因多种多样,以下是一些常见原因: 1.ISO镜像加载问题:VMware在尝试挂载VMware Tools ISO镜像时可能遇到加载失败,导致安装程序无法启动
2.权限问题:虚拟机中的用户权限不足,无法执行安装程序
3.操作系统兼容性:VMware Tools的版本与虚拟机中的操作系统版本不兼容,导致安装失败
4.挂载点问题:虚拟机中的挂载点配置错误或已被占用,导致ISO镜像无法正确挂载
5.安装程序损坏:下载的VMware Tools ISO镜像文件损坏,无法执行安装程序
6.网络问题:在某些情况下,网络配置错误或网络中断可能导致安装过程中无法下载必要的文件
7.防火墙或安全软件:主机或虚拟机上的防火墙或安全软件可能阻止VMware Tools的安装过程
三、解决VMware Tools安装出错的实战指南 针对上述原因,以下是一些详细的解决方案: 1. 检查ISO镜像加载情况 - 手动挂载ISO镜像:在VMware Workstation或Fusion中,可以通过虚拟机设置手动挂载VMware Tools ISO镜像
确保镜像文件路径正确,且虚拟机已正确识别并挂载
- 重启虚拟机:在挂载ISO镜像后,重启虚拟机以确保系统能够正确识别并加载ISO镜像
2. 提升用户权限 - 以管理员身份运行:在虚拟机中,确保以管理员或具有足够权限的用户身份运行VMware Tools安装程序
- 检查SELinux或AppArmor状态:如果虚拟机运行的是Linux系统,检查SELinux或AppArmor的状态,确保它们不会阻止VMware Tools的安装
3. 检查操作系统兼容性 - 下载正确版本的VMware Tools:根据虚拟机中操作系统的版本,下载并安装相应版本的VMware Tools
- 更新操作系统:如果操作系统版本过旧,考虑升级到受支持的版本,以便使用最新版本的VMware Tools
4. 检查挂载点配置 - 创建新的挂载点:在虚拟机中创建一个新的挂载点,并确保该挂载点未被其他程序占用
- 检查文件系统类型:确保挂载点的文件系统类型与VMware Tools ISO镜像的文件系统类型兼容
5. 验证ISO镜像完整性 - 重新下载ISO镜像:如果怀疑ISO镜像文件损坏,尝试从VMware官方网站重新下载
- 使用校验工具:下载后,使用校验工具(如MD5或SHA-256)验证ISO镜像文件的完整性
6. 检查网络配置 - 检查网络连接:确保虚拟机与主机之间的网络连接正常
- 配置NAT或桥接网络:根据需要配置NAT或桥接网络,确保虚拟机能够访问外部网络
7. 禁用防火墙或安全软件 - 临时禁用防火墙:在安装VMware Tools期间,尝试临时禁用主机或虚拟机上的防火墙
- 配置安全软件例外:如果无法禁用防火墙或安全软件,尝试将它们配置为允许VMware Tools的安装过程
四、高级故障排除技巧 如果上述方法均未能解决问题,可以尝试以下高级故障排除技巧: - 查看日志文件:检查虚拟机中的日志文件(如`/var/log/vmware-tools-installer.log`对于Linux系统),以获取有关安装失败的详细信息
- 使用命令行安装:对于Linux系统,可以尝试使用命令行方式安装VMware Tools,以获取更详细的错误信息
- 联系VMware支持:如果问题依然无法解决,可以联系VMware的技术支持团队,寻求专业帮助
五、总结 VMware Tools的安装出错是一个复杂且多变的问题,但通过上述的深入分析和实战指南,大多数用户应该能够找到并解决安装过程中遇到的问题
关键在于仔细检查每一步操作,确保所有配置都正确无误
同时,保持VMware软件和操作系统的更新也是预防此类问题的重要措施
希望本文能够帮助用户顺利安装VMware Tools,享受虚拟化技术带来的便利与高效